1 Anycast Address Assignment Using DHCPv6 draft-madanapalli-dhcpv6-anycast-00 Syam Madanapalli Samsung ISO IETF 61 – Washington, DC.

Slides:



Advertisements
Similar presentations
IPv6 The New Internet Protocol Integrated Network Services Almerindo Graziano.
Advertisements

Transitioning to IPv6 April 15,2005 Presented By: Richard Moore PBS Enterprise Technology.
IPv4 to IPv6 Migration strategies. What is IPv4  Second revision in development of internet protocol  First version to be widely implied.  Connection.
IPV6. Features of IPv6 New header format Large address space More efficient routing IPsec header support required Simple automatic configuration New protocol.
Network Layer IPv6 Slides were original prepared by Dr. Tatsuya Suda.
Module 4: Configuring Network Connectivity
IPv6 Network Security.
Network Localized Mobility Management using DHCP
Draft-ietf-dhc-stateless-dhcpv6- renumbering-01 Tim Chown dhc WG, IETF 60, San Diego, August 2, 2004.
© 2008 Cisco Systems, Inc. All rights reserved.Cisco ConfidentialPresentation_ID 1 Chapter 10: DHCP Routing & Switching.
© 2008 Cisco Systems, Inc. All rights reserved.Cisco ConfidentialPresentation_ID 1 Chapter 10: DHCP Routing and Switching Essentials.
1 Behcet Sarikaya Frank Xia July 2010 Flexible DHCPv6 Prefix Delegation in Mobile Networks IETF 78
Module 4: Configuring Network Connectivity
DNS zone suffix option for DHCPv6 (draft-yan-dhc-dhcpv6-opt-dnszone-02.txt) IETF 62 (Minneapolis) Yan Renxiang Alcatel Shanghai Bell.
1 Service-Oriented Address Assignment Using DHCP draft-ietf-dhc-soa-option-00.txt draft-syam-dhc-soav4-option-00.txt Syam Madanapalli Samsung ISO IETF.
1IETF56 DNSOP WG The Autoconfiguration of Recursive DNS Server and the Optimization of DNS Name Resolution in Hierarchical Mobile IPv6 Jae-Hoon Jeong,
1IETF59 DNSOP WG IPv6 DNS Discovery Issues Jaehoon Paul Jeong ETRI 1st March th IETF – Seoul,
Multicast DNS Draft-aboba-dnsext-mdns-00.txt. Outline Goals and objectives Scope of the multicast DNS DNS server discovery Non-zeroconf behavior Zeroconf.
CS 6401 IPv6 Outline Background Structure Deployment.
Guide to TCP/IP Fourth Edition
Guide to TCP/IP, Second Edition1 Guide To TCP/IP, Second Edition Chapter 8 The Dynamic Host Configuration Protocol (DHCP)
IPv6 RADIUS attributes for IPv6 access networks draft-lourdelet-radext-ipv6-access-01 Glen Zorn, Benoit Lourdelet Wojciech Dec, Behcet Sarikaya Radext/dhc.
IPv6 Address autoconfiguration stateless & stateful.
DNS zone suffix option for DHCPv6 (draft-yan-dhc-dhcpv6-opt-dnszone-01.txt) IETF 61 (Washington, DC) Yinglan Jiang Renxiang Yan
© 2008 Cisco Systems, Inc. All rights reserved.Cisco ConfidentialPresentation_ID 1 Chapter 10: DHCP Routing and Switching Essentials.
© 2008 Cisco Systems, Inc. All rights reserved.Cisco ConfidentialPresentation_ID 1 Chapter 10: DHCP Routing & Switching.
Using DHCPv6 for DNS Configuration in Hosts draft-ietf-droms-dnsconfig-dhcpv6-00.txt Ralph Droms.
Prefix Delegation Protocol Selection T.J. Kniveton MEXT Working Group IETF 70 - December ’07 - Vancouver.
1 Behcet Sarikaya Frank Xia Ted Lemon July 2011 DHCPv6 Prefix Delegation as IPv6 Migration Tool in Mobile Networks IETF 81
Autonomic Prefix Management in Large-scale Networks ANIMA WG IETF 91, November 2014 draft-jiang-anima-prefix-management Sheng Jiang Brian Carpenter Qiong.
DHC WG IETF 55, 11/18/ /18/2002IETF 552 Agenda Administrivia, agenda bashingRalph Droms Use of IPsec for Securing DHCPv4 Messages Exchanged Between.
Guide to TCP/IP, Third Edition Chapter 8: The Dynamic Host Configuration Protocol.
Exposing Source IP Address Type Requirements with DHCPv6 D. Moses, A. Yegin draft-moses-dmm-dhcp-ondemand-mobility-00.
© 2006 Cisco Systems, Inc. All rights reserved. BSCI v3.0—8-1 Implementing IPv6 Implementing Dynamic IPv6 Addresses.
DHCP Options for Configuring Tenant Identifier and Multicast Addresses in Overlay Networks Behcet Sarikaya Frank Xia.
4: Network Layer4b-1 IPv6 r Initial motivation: 32-bit address space completely allocated by r Additional motivation: m header format helps speed.
Advanced Roaming & Mobility Scenarios in IPv6 Rafal Lukawiecki Strategic Consultant & Director Project Botticelli Ltd in.
© Cengage Learning 2014 How IP Addresses Get Assigned A MAC address is embedded on a network adapter at a factory IP addresses are assigned manually or.
Module 6: IPv6 Fundamentals. Introduction to IPv6 Unicast IPv6 Addresses Configuring IPv6.
Dynamic Stateless GRE Tunnel Li Xue Dayong Guo 1.
IPv4 over IEEE IP CS draft-ietf-16ng-ipv4-over-802-dot-16-ipcs-03 Samita Chakrabarti IP Infusion Syam Madanapalli Ordyn Technologies Daniel Park.
(ITI310) By Eng. BASSEM ALSAID SESSIONS 9: Dynamic Host Configuration Protocol (DHCP)
A Optimal Load-balance mechanism for NAT64 (OL-NAT) draft-chen-behave-olnat-01 Gang Chen; Hui Deng;
DHCP options for PAA Status report of draft-ietf-dhc-paa-option-01.txt Lionel Morand IETF-65, Dallas.
DHCPv6 States DHCPv6 Client State DHCPv6 Server State.
IPv6 Services for Residential Networks Mark Baugher Erwan Nedellec Mika Saaranen Barbara Stark.
1/7 zerouter BoF Problem Statement 19 th Nov th IETF - Atlanta, Georgia, USA
DHCPv4 option for PANA Authentication Agents draft-suraj-dhcpv4-paa-option-00.txt DHC/PANA WG IETF-63 France, Paris.
IETF 78 RADIUS extensions for DS-Lite draft-maglione-softwire-dslite-radius-ext-00 R. Maglione – Telecom Italia A. Durand – Juniper Networks.
Draft-ietf-v6ops-addcon-01.txt IPv6 Unicast Address Assignment Considerations Gunter Van de Velde (editor), Tim Chown, Ciprian Popoviciu, Olaf Bonness,
Exposing Source IP Address Type Requirements with DHCPv6 D. Moses, A. Yegin draft-moses-dmm-dhcp-ondemand-mobility-02.
CHAPTER 10: DHCP Routing & Switching. Objectives 10.0 Introduction 10.1 Dynamic Host Configuration Protocol v Dynamic Host Configuration Protocol.
Instructor Materials Chapter 8: DHCP
Mukul Goyal University of Wisconsin Milwaukee
IPv6 Overview Address space Address types IPv6 and Tunneling.
Gateway-Initiated 4over6 Deployment
CIS 116 IPv6 Fundamentals 2 – Primer Rick Graziani Cabrillo College
Syam Madanapalli Basavaraj Patil Erik Nordmark JinHyeock Choi
Chapter 6 Exploring IPv6.
Lightweight 4over6 deployment with DHCPv4 over DHCPv6
Lionel Morand DHCP options for PAA Lionel Morand
IPv6 / IP Next Generation
Ch.8 Dynamic IPv6 Address Allocation
TURN Server Auto Discovery draft-patil-tram-turn-serv-disc-01
Link Layer Addresses Assignment Mechanism for DHCPv6
Chapter 26 IPv6 Addressing
By : Santosh Yadav IIT Kanpur
Proposal for IEEE 802.1CQ-LAAP
IPv6 Addresses Hwajung Lee Key Reference:
Link Layer Addresses Assignment Mechanism for DHCPv6
Presentation transcript:

1 Anycast Address Assignment Using DHCPv6 draft-madanapalli-dhcpv6-anycast-00 Syam Madanapalli Samsung ISO IETF 61 – Washington, DC

2 Agenda Background & Motivation Background & Motivation Summary of the Draft Summary of the Draft How It Works How It Works Anycast Address Assignment Option Anycast Address Assignment Option Service Discovery Option Service Discovery Option Comments & Questions Comments & Questions

3 Background & Motivation… Currently the DHCPv6 defines the following options for different kinds of address assignments Currently the DHCPv6 defines the following options for different kinds of address assignments IA_NA – Permanent Unicast Addresses IA_NA – Permanent Unicast Addresses IA_TA – Temporary Unicast Addresses IA_TA – Temporary Unicast Addresses IA_MA – Multicast Addresses IA_MA – Multicast Addresses IPv6 has another type of address IPv6 has another type of address Anycast Address Anycast Address Expected to have wide scope of usability Expected to have wide scope of usability New BoF is planned in IETF to work on Anycasting in IPv6 New BoF is planned in IETF to work on Anycasting in IPv6

4 Background & Motivation There exist no method for Assigning the Service Oriented Addresses There exist no method for Assigning the Service Oriented Addresses Anycast Addresses/Shared Unicast Addresses Anycast Addresses/Shared Unicast Addresses Service-oriented/Well-known Unicast Addresses Service-oriented/Well-known Unicast Addresses Anycast Servers are need to explicitly configured to know that it is an Anycast Address Anycast Servers are need to explicitly configured to know that it is an Anycast Address So that it will not use the Anycast Address as the Source Address So that it will not use the Anycast Address as the Source Address

5 Summary of the draft Provides a way for Service-Oriented Address Assignment Provides a way for Service-Oriented Address Assignment Anycast Addresses Anycast Addresses Shared Unicast Addresses Shared Unicast Addresses Service-oriented/Well-known Unicast Addresses Service-oriented/Well-known Unicast Addresses Similar to other types of address assignments Similar to other types of address assignments But here the address assignment is for a Service But here the address assignment is for a Service Introduces a new name space – Service Type Introduces a new name space – Service Type DNS Server, SIP Servers, Web Servers, Tunnel Servers etc. DNS Server, SIP Servers, Web Servers, Tunnel Servers etc.

6 How It Works DHCPv6 Server DNS Server Solicit (AA Option) Reply (Anycast Address) Solicit (AA Option) Reply (Anycast Address) Information Request (DNS Server) Reply (DNS Server Address)

7 Anycast Address Assignment Option IAID identifies this IA IAID identifies this IA This name space different from IA_NA and IA_TA This name space different from IA_NA and IA_TA Service Type Service Type The type of the service that the server provides The type of the service that the server provides A – Flag A – Flag Indicates if it is an Anycast Address Indicates if it is an Anycast Address IA_AA Options IA_AA Options IA Address Options carrying the addresses for this Service Type IA Address Options carrying the addresses for this Service Type 031 IA_AA Options OPTION_IA_AA IAID (4 octets) Option Length T1 T2 Service TypeAReserved

8 Service Discovery Option OPTION_SRVC_DSCVRY OPTION_SRVC_DSCVRY One Option for all types of Servers (?) One Option for all types of Servers (?) Service Type Service Type The type of the service that the client trying to discover The type of the service that the client trying to discover OPTION_SRVC_DSCVRY Options OPTION_SRVC_DSCVRY Options IA Address Options carrying the addresses for the Service Type IA Address Options carrying the addresses for the Service Type 031 OPTION_SRVC_DSCVRYOption Length Service TypeReserved OPTION_SRVC_DSCVRY Options

9 Questions & Comments

10 Thank You